Retailers Fighting To No Longer Store Credit Data

Posted by Zonk on Fri Oct 05, 2007 02:25 PM
from the just-going-to-get-stolen-anyway dept.
Technical Writing Geek writes with the news that the retail industry is getting mighty fed up over credit card company policies requiring them to store payment data. The National Retail Federation (NRF) has gone to bat for store owners, asking the credit industry to change their policies. The frustration stems from payment card industry (PCI) standards and new security measures going into place across the retail experience. Retailers are now trying to point out that many of the elements of the standard would not be a requirement if they didn't have to store so much payment data. "Even if the NRF's demands were immediately met, it would take several years before retailers could purge their systems and applications of credit card data, he said. Over the years, retailers have collected and stored credit card data in myriad systems and places -- including relatively old legacy environments -- and they are just now realizing the data can be a challenge, he said. Purging it can be a bigger headache because the data is often inextricably linked to and used by a variety of customer and marketing applications; simply removing it could cause huge disruptions."

    • Re:Data Theft (Score:5, Interesting)

      by CastrTroy (595695) on Friday October 05 2007, @02:43PM (#20872363) Homepage
      I had a professor in univesity for one of my security classes. Basically, he told us that SSL, while it's good at what it does, doesn't really solve the real security issues with transactions happening over the internet. Nobody sniffs the wire or does man in the middle attacks to collect the data, because it's often very difficult, and requires physical access to cables. What they usually do is just break into the back end database that's storing all this data. It's much easier. Him and some of his colleagues came up with a much better system, whereby the credit card info never went to the retailer, but instead just a digital certificate signed by the credit card company that would authorize a payment for some certain amount. In the end, the industry decided not to go with that standard, because it was harder to implement. It solved the real problem, but SSL was adopted because they figured it was good enough. It's interesting to see that decision coming back when if they would have just done it right the first time, we'd have much less problems.

        I'm sure your professor's solution was quite elegant, but I must point out that this is completely unnecessary in practical applications since most payment gateways support a method of integration where the credit card data is never passed to the merchant. AuthorizeNet's Simple Integration Method (SIM) is one example of this. The customer is either redirected to the payment gateway's website (SSL encrypted) or the site is presented in an IFRAME. The gateway then sends the result back to the merchant.

    • The standards don't make the companies save the data. On the contrary, they PROHIBIT saving the data. The problem is that a lot of PCI systems save the data by default, and merchants either can't figure out how to stop it, or try to stop it but the software saves it anyway. Few of the vendors getting vendors getting caught deliberately save it for their own convenience.

      These are turnkey systems designed to be operated by non-experts. Naughty naughty code.

    • Re:Well (Score:5, Insightful)

      by MortimerV (896247) on Friday October 05 2007, @02:44PM (#20872371) Homepage
      Why should the credit card data have to be stored by both the retailer and the CC company?

      Let the CC company keep a transaction ID and all confidential information, and the retailer keeps the same transaction ID, along with purchase details. That puts the burden of security all in one place, with the CC company, rather than scattered around with all the various retailers.

      And if there's a trail to be followed, the CC company and retailer can compare records through the transaction ID.
      • Credit card companies do provide such a number. If you don't have to do multiple transactions on the card, you don't have to store the actual card number after it's used. The problem is that companies want to have their cake and eat it too, store the card for repeated transactions or customer convenience, but they don't want to change their systems to store them securely.

    • Thats part of the mandate of PCI compliance. Problem is, encryption is easy, key managment is hard. Where do you store the keys, who gets access to them? How do you know they're going to do the right thing with them? Who audits these processes? How do you know the encryption process is secure? How do you make sure it stays that way after deployment?

  • Several Issues (Score:4, Insightful)

    by wardred (602136) on Friday October 05 2007, @03:18PM (#20872837) Homepage
    There are at least two issues with credit card data based on this article. I definitely like the retailer's NOT storing full credit card data. The credit card type, possibly the bank, the card holder's name, the last few digits of the credit card number, and the charge date and time should be more than enough to identify a transaction, especially if there's a transaction id. The credit card companies HAVE to have full account data, but the more systems this data is stored in, the less secure it is, no matter what security is implemented at each individual site. If you can remove the bank and CC number entirely and work strictly off of transaction ID and card type, I'd be even happier. Storing this minimum of data would allow everybody to identify a particular charge if there's a dispute about charges, would still allow retailers to generate whatever statistical data they need, and would prevent identity thieves from getting full CC numbers, expiration dates, etc. from retailers.

    On the other hand, retailers still need to secure whatever legacy data they have, and work on purging the systems that store it. These are two different problems, and both sides of this debate seem to want to point out the problems with their opponent's positions without addressing their own issues. If retailers have the data and aren't securing it, then I have little sympathy for them when they get heavily fined for not treating our sensitive data properly, even if the CC companies require the storage of some of that data and shouldn't. Especially for major retailers where the IT budget can be spread across many, many stores.

    So, short term solution is to get the retail stores to abide by the current security regulations posted by CC companies. The longer term solution is to get a more sane set of security solutions from the CC companies, and make it so that every retail outlet is required NOT to store sensitive data that crackers might want to get a hold of. This would reduce the number of outlets to our sensitive data to a minimum. It would reduce it to the companies that have to retain that data anyway.

  • by MattyMatt (57008) on Friday October 05 2007, @03:57PM (#20873367)
    I've been working with a PCI certified auditor for close to nine months now to bring my company into compliance with the latest Data Security Standard. The DSS is a great source if you're looking for a concise primer on good development, administration and training practices, but... Bringing a company into compliance with all the requirements is incredibly difficult. No exaggeration, we've spent tens of thousands of dollars on the audit itself, tens of thousands more on infrastructure and the equivalent of one full time employee working on nothing but DSS compliance for the past year. Once we receive the stamp of compliance from the Payment Card Industry, we just have to turn around and do it all over again next year, the following year, the year after that, etc... Granted, once we get through the first audit, the following audits will be less expensive from a time and money perspective, but we're still looking at anywhere from ten to fifty grand a year for the certified auditor and any DSS mandated changes to our system. For example, the DSS requires for 2008 either an application layer firewall in front of web-facing apps or third-party code review. There goes my bonus for next year... Long story short - very few companies are going to be able to meet the Payment Card Industry Data Security Standard and on top of that, most companies don't want to store freakin' payment card anyway.

  • It's very simple (Score:5, Interesting)

    by sjames (1099) on Friday October 05 2007, @04:04PM (#20873463) Homepage

    In spite of the smokescreen being thrown up by the big credit cards, it's really very simple.

    The banks ALREADY have and must keep all of the information. Their byzantine PCI standards demand that the merchants keep a full duplicate of this highly sensitive data and dictate how it must be stored. The merchants maintain (correctly) that if the banks had as much intelligence as a slug all they would need to retain is non-sensitive (and useless to identity thieves) transaction/approval numbers rather than very sensitive cc numbers and identifying info.

    In other words, in spite of what the banks claim, this is about reducing the risks and liabilities rather than shifting them. In fact, it's the banks that are trying to spread liability by maintaining a situation where they can plausibly play the blame game.

    Various schemes have been available for DECADES to make sure that fraudulant credit transactions can not happen but the banks have fought against them tooth and nail in order to keep the current approach where name and cc number are all that's needed to commit fraud. They're also the ones that have been routinely offering big limit credit cards to toddlers, dogs, and cats then trying to stick innocent 3rd parties with the liabilities.

    The entire identity theft problem only exists because of the very same banks. I'll bet that it would all stop instantly if a law was passed banning any attempt at collections for credit card debt unless the bank can present a picture of the alleged debtor actually signing the agreement for the account AND that without a digital transaction signature, the cardholder is presumed NOT to be liable for the charge. You can be assured that credit cards with useful smart chips and public key signature capability would be implemented the INSTANT such a law went into effect.

  • When I supported POS systems five years ago I was amazed at what they would store in plain text in log files. Not just CC numbers but the entire contents of the magnetic strip. And POS software is a very stagnant industry, once retailers have a system that works they're very slow to change. Hell, I know of one convenience store chain that is still running Windows 95 with a WinNT back of house.
